本文目录导读:
解决谷歌下载文件名符号乱码问题
目录导读:
-
介绍谷歌下载文件名符号乱码的问题及其影响。
-
原因分析
探讨导致谷歌下载文件名符号乱码的具体因素。
-
解决方案
提供多种有效的解决方法,包括调整浏览器设置、使用特殊编码方式等。
-
注意事项与预防措施
分享在遇到类似问题时的应对策略和预防方案。
-
总结解决谷歌下载文件名符号乱码的关键点,并强调其重要性。
随着互联网技术的发展,人们通过谷歌下载文件已成为日常生活的一部分,在某些情况下,文件下载过程中可能会遇到文件名中包含特殊字符的问题,/”、“\”或空格等问题,这些会导致下载文件失败或者无法正常显示,本文将探讨如何解决谷歌下载文件名中的符号乱码问题,并提供一些建议以防止此类问题的发生。
原因分析:
谷歌下载文件过程中遇到的符号乱码问题主要是由于以下几个方面的原因所致:
- 网页缓存问题:有时候网页缓存未清理干净,导致部分HTML代码无法正确解析,从而产生乱码现象。
- 特殊字符处理不匹配:文件系统在处理特殊字符(如斜杠、回车换行等)时可能出现兼容性问题,导致下载异常。
- 服务器端配置问题:服务器端可能对特殊字符的处理不当,导致下载页面加载错误,进而引发乱码问题。
解决方案:
针对上述原因,以下是几种有效解决谷歌下载文件名符号乱码的方法:
-
手动清除缓存: 打开浏览器设置,找到缓存管理选项,点击“清除浏览数据”,然后选择下载相关的缓存项进行清理,这可以显著减少网页缓存带来的乱码问题。
-
调整HTTP响应头: 在下载文件前,尝试修改HTTP请求头部,添加Content-Type字段,使其明确指定文件类型,对于文本文件,可设置为"text/plain";对于图片,可设置为'image/jpeg',这样可以确保浏览器正确识别文件格式并避免乱码问题。
-
使用特殊编码方式: 在下载文件的过程中,可以尝试使用特殊的URL编码格式,比如Base64编码,将路径"/"替换为"%2F",将" "替换为空格,从而避免特殊字符引起的乱码问题。
-
检查服务器配置: 如果是在服务器端处理下载文件,需要确认服务器对特殊字符的支持情况,如果服务器不支持特殊字符,可以通过编程语言或脚本对文件名进行转换,使其能够被服务器正确识别。
注意事项与预防措施:
在面对谷歌下载文件名符号乱码的问题时,还需要注意以下几点:
- 定期更新浏览器插件:一些老版本的插件可能导致缓存问题,及时更新相关插件有助于解决这类问题。
- 备份下载文件:为了避免下载过程中的数据丢失,建议在下载之前做好备份工作。
- 测试环境模拟:在正式部署之前,可以在测试环境中进行文件下载操作,观察是否有乱码问题,并据此调整参数和策略。
通过以上步骤,可以有效地解决谷歌下载文件名符号乱码的问题,并提高文件下载的成功率和用户体验。
本文链接:https://sobatac.com/google/109646.html 转载需授权!